Fertile Ground was a parenting compzine edited by Stacey Greenberg of Memphis, Tennessee, U.S.A.

Subtitled "For people who dig parenting," the zine consisted of personal anecdotes about parenting from mothers and mothers-to-be, as well as book reviews, essays, and cartoons.

Sixteen issues were published between January 2003 and December 2007.
